1. Content Acquisition and Encoding
The first step in the process is content acquisition. This involves capturing the live sports event or obtaining pre-recorded footage. This can be done through various means, such as professional cameras, broadcast feeds, or even user-generated content. Once the content is acquired, it needs to be encoded into a digital format suitable for streaming over the internet. Encoding involves compressing the video and audio data to reduce file sizes while maintaining acceptable quality. Popular encoding formats include H.264 and H.265 (HEVC), which offer a good balance between compression efficiency and video quality. The encoding process also involves setting parameters like resolution, frame rate, and bitrate, which determine the overall quality of the stream.

3. Content Delivery Network (CDN)
As mentioned earlier, a Content Delivery Network (CDN) is a network of geographically distributed servers that cache content closer to end-users. When a viewer requests a sports stream, the CDN automatically directs the request to the server that is closest to the viewer's location. This reduces latency and ensures faster loading times, resulting in a smoother viewing experience. CDNs are particularly important for live sports events, where millions of viewers may be tuning in simultaneously. Popular CDN providers include Akamai, Cloudflare, and Amazon CloudFront. These providers have extensive networks of servers around the world and offer advanced features like dynamic content acceleration and DDoS protection.
4. Streaming Protocols
Streaming protocols are the rules and standards that govern how video and audio data are transmitted over the internet. Several streaming protocols are commonly used in IP Sport Distribution Sepurpanse, including HTTP Live Streaming (HLS), Dynamic Adaptive Streaming over HTTP (DASH), and Real-Time Messaging Protocol (RTMP). HLS and DASH are adaptive bitrate streaming protocols, which means that they can automatically adjust the quality of the stream based on the viewer's internet connection speed. This ensures that viewers with slower connections can still watch the content without experiencing buffering or interruptions. RTMP is an older protocol that is still used for live streaming, but it is gradually being replaced by HLS and DASH due to their superior performance and compatibility.
5. Digital Rights Management (DRM)
Digital Rights Management (DRM) is a set of technologies used to protect copyrighted content from piracy and unauthorized access. In IP Sport Distribution Sepurpanse, DRM is used to prevent viewers from recording or redistributing the sports streams. DRM systems typically involve encrypting the content and requiring viewers to authenticate before they can access it. Popular DRM solutions include Widevine, PlayReady, and FairPlay. Implementing DRM is essential for protecting the rights of content owners and ensuring that they can monetize their sports content effectively.

2. Latency Issues
Latency, or delay, is a critical issue in IP Sport Distribution Sepurpanse, particularly for live sports events. Viewers expect to see the action in real-time, and any significant delay can be frustrating. Latency can be caused by various factors, such as encoding delays, network congestion, and CDN propagation delays. Broadcasters need to minimize latency as much as possible to provide a seamless viewing experience. This may involve using low-latency encoding techniques, optimizing network configurations, and selecting CDNs with low latency performance.
